Precision Enzymatic Management and Process Stability
Enzymatic reactors deliver secure, stable platforms for biochemical substrate conversion while maintaining structural integrity under significant operational loads.
Advanced Thermal Regulation: Engineered with optimized shell thicknesses and specialized heat transfer interfaces to maintain precise temperature control for enzyme activity and stability
Optimized Internal Dynamics: Strategic internal geometry and high-performance agitation systems ensure material homogeneity without damaging sensitive biocatalysts
Precision Environmental Isolation: Integrated sealing systems and precision sensors maintain controlled internal atmospheres and pH levels for batch reproducibility
Structural Design for Industrial Durability
Built for continuous operation in high-capacity production lines, these reactors withstand thermal expansion, mechanical loads, and varied industrial environments.
High-Grade Material Construction: Fabricated from 304 or 316L stainless steel for exceptional tensile strength and corrosion resistance
Certified Pressure Capability: Designed to international standards (ASME Section VIII, PED) for structural safety under varying pressure conditions
Superior Surface Finishes: Accessible maintenance features and high-quality internal finishes like mirror polishing for efficient cleaning and inspection
